Definitions for condignnesses
  • Condign (a.) - Worthy; suitable; deserving; fit.
  • Condign (a.) - Deserved; adequate; suitable to the fault or crime.
  • Condignity (n.) - Merit, acquired by works, which can claim reward on the score of general benevolence.
  • Condignly (adv.) - According to merit.
  • Condignness (n.) - Agreeableness to deserts; suitableness.
